The CD time Information will not be displayed. 1) USING THE REPEAT FEATURE The default mode for the Repeat feature is OFF. Pressing REPEAT consecutively changes the repeat options: • REP-ONE- repeats the track that is playing. • REP-ALL- repeats the disc that is playing. • REPEAT OFF- resume norma playback. As you toggle through the options, the repeat option changes. The selected repeat option loops repeatedly until you turn it off. 17
